- [ ] Step 7: Archive cold storage buckets (Glacierline tier). Confirm both ceremony witnesses are present, verify bucket manifests match the Oxbow ledger, then seal the archive key shares. Plugin authors may observe but not handle shares. Once sealed, the archive index itself is encrypted and can only be reopened with the passphrase below.

vault phrase of badup-hahig = tamael-aldael-kelmir-istael-fenok-istwyn-tamius-jorath-oliion

# Basement Archive Room — Night Access

The archive room under Pellworth House holds old contracts and the tape backups. Night shift: take stairwell C, not the lift (it's switched off after midnight). Lights are on a timer by the door — slap the button as you go in. Sign the logbook, even at 3am, yes really. The keypad by the door takes the code below.

staff pass of fahap-tajeg = bdg-FT-6

## Formula sandbox tuning

User-supplied formulas in Gridmoor execute inside a restricted interpreter with hard ceilings on time, memory, and call depth. Reviewers should confirm any change to these ceilings is justified in the PR description, since raising them widens the abuse surface. Defaults were chosen from production traces. The current limits are as follows.

limits module of tafog-fawip:
WEIGHTS = {
    "julix": 57,
    "lamys": 992,
    "kasvan": 209,
    "quenok": 750,
    "alddor": 259,
    "oliath": 1009,
    "wenix": 815,
}